Size
The oven is one the most used appliances in the kitchen. It is therefore crucial to choose the right size to meet your needs. Single ovens are available in a variety of sizes, ranging from 30 to 60 litres, which means you can choose the ideal one for your space.
The ideal size is based on your cooking habits and lifestyle. Cooks who are frequent may require more space to cook meals for several people. If you're a novice or have a limited bench space think about smaller models.
You can also take into account the unit's height and depth when selecting an electric built-in single oven. The height of the oven can differ between models, but the majority of them are designed to be on the same level as your cabinets. The oven's depth can vary too however they're typically between 22 and 24 inches.

Functions
The kind of oven you pick can make a significant impact on your cooking since different models provide various functions and features. Some of the most beneficial include the fan-assisted function, which utilises fans to circulate hot air and accelerate your cooking times. This is perfect for baking or roasting dishes. Other functions include the standard oven setting, which heats the lower and upper elements for more traditional results. Some models even come with steam functions that help preserve the tenderness and moisture of dishes like casseroles, poultry, and custards.
Self-cleaning ovens are designed to save you time. Pyrolytic cleaning utilizes high temperatures to incinerate food and grease residues and reduce the necessity for manual scrubbing. Steam clean uses lower intensity of heat to give a gentler clean with fewer chemicals.
Another feature worth considering is the minute minder, which triggers an audible alarm when your set cooking time has elapsed. This feature is especially useful when cooking recipes that require precise timing. Other functions include the grill, which utilizes the heat from the top element to cook your food quickly and evenly, as well as the defrost function, which delicately and safely defrosts frozen foods in the oven without requiring any water.
Some models come with an option for top-browning that only powers the upper part of the. This lets you achieve a crisper finish for casseroles, lasagnes moussakas, naans, and cauliflower cheese. The warming function is ideal for keeping plates and naans warm and is ideal to finish off meals that don't require a full roasting.
